Why a Pre-Purchase Building Inspection Tauranga Is Critical
When shopping for property, it’s easy to get caught up in the excitement of potential. However, a house’s appearance can sometimes hide underlying issues. A pre-purchase building inspection is an expert service that thoroughly assesses the property’s condition, uncovering defects, risks, and areas needing attention.
Here are some key reasons why a pre-purchase building inspection Tauranga is vital:
- Identifies hidden problems: Issues such as dampness, structural faults, or electrical hazards can be missed during a casual viewing. A detailed report sheds light on what’s beneath the surface.
- Informs negotiation: Knowledge of the property’s condition allows buyers to negotiate a fairer price or request repairs before settlement.
- Protects your investment: Major repairs often cost thousands of dollars. Early detection helps you avoid unwelcome surprises.
- Provides peace of mind: Knowing the true state of the property makes the buying process less stressful and more transparent.
What Functions Do Home Inspectors Serve in Tauranga?
Home inspectors, like those at Tauranga House Inspections, are trained professionals who specialize in assessing residential properties. Their expertise ensures that every aspect of the building is scrutinized for safety, durability, and compliance.
Key responsibilities of home inspectors include:
- Examining structural components: Foundations, walls, ceilings, and roofing structures.
- Inspecting electrical and plumbing systems: Ensuring everything is up to code and functioning properly.
- Assessing insulation, ventilation, and heating: For energy efficiency and indoor air quality.
- Detecting moisture issues and mold: Preventing long-term damage and health risks.
- Reviewing building compliance: Confirming the property meets local building standards.

3. Healthy Homes Inspections
In compliance with New Zealand healthy homes standards, this inspection assesses insulation, moisture, ventilation, and heating to ensure the property promotes a healthy indoor environment.

Frequently Asked Questions About Pre-purchase Building Inspections Tauranga
Q1: How long does a pre-purchase building inspection take?
Typically, a thorough inspection takes between 2 to 4 hours, depending on the size of the property.
Q2: What does a building inspection report include?
It includes an overall condition summary, detailed findings for each area inspected, photographs, and repair recommendations.
Q3: Can I attend the inspection?
Yes, clients are encouraged to attend, ask questions, and gain firsthand knowledge about the property’s condition.
Q4: Are building inspections mandatory?
While not legally required, a building inspection is highly recommended for any significant property transaction.
